Job summary

Adams and Associates, Inc. is seeking a Records Manager to lead our student records team, ensuring data integrity, confidentiality, and timely service.

You will train staff, oversee the records function, and ensure compliance with regulations while supporting students with their records and schedules. The role requires supervisory experience, strong computer skills, and a commitment to accuracy and confidentiality.

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ent required; degree or certification preferred.
  • Minimum two years of supervisory experience in records management or related field.
  • Strong computer skills with spreadsheets and word processing.

Responsibilities

  • Maintain the integrity and confidentiality of student data following guidelines and procedures.
  • Train and supervise staff to maintain a motivated and accountable team.
  • Plan, schedule, and manage the Student Records function and related reports.
  • Audit records weekly and monthly for accuracy and compliance.
  • Assist students with pay, allowances, leave, scheduling, and transportation matters.
  • Ensure reconciliation of government travel expenses per DOL guidelines.
  • Serve as Accountability Officer, monitoring attendance and documentation.
